Montgomery County released information about voting by mail and in person for the upcoming Municipal Election on Tuesday, November 4.
The deadline to register to vote is Monday, October 20, and the deadline to request a mail-in ballot is Tuesday, October 28, according to county officials.
The Montgomery County Mobile Voter Services Outreach Van, which debuted last year, will be making appearances across the county starting Monday, October 6. You can visit the calendar for an updated schedule.
In the Ambler area, secure drop-off boxes are open 24 hours a day, seven days a week at the following locations starting at noon on October 17:
- Upper Dublin Magisterial District Courts • 1301 S. Bethlehem Pike
- Upper Dublin Library • 520 Virginia Drive • Fort Washington
- Lansdale Magisterial District Courts • 430 Pennbrook Pkwy
